    Summary: util-linux security update

    Details: The util-linux package contains a random collection of files that implements some low-level basic linux utilities. Security Fix(es): An integer overflow in util-linux through 2.37.1 can potentially cause a buffer overflow if an attacker were able to use system resources in a way that leads to a large number in the /proc/sysvipc/sem file.(CVE-2021-37600)
